Emma Watson In Talks To Play Cinderella

Emma Watson appears to be trading in her wizard robes for a glass slipper.

According to Variety, the actress is in talks to star in Disney’s live action “Cinderella.”

The latest fairytale movie will be directed by Kenneth Branagh, with Cate Blanchett slated to play the wicked stepmother.

Emma, who was last seen in “The Perks of Being a Wallflower,” was first approached in 2009 to play the princess in a musical project that Marilyn Manson was going to write and direct.

First up, Emma will be seen in Darren Aronofsky’s “Noah,” and then will co-star with Seth Rogen and Evan Goldberg in “This is the End,” and has also signed on to the David Yates drama “Your Voice in My Head.”

“Cinderella” is slated to start shooting in the fall, with a potential release date in 2014.
